Qingwei Zhitong pellets is a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M) formulation used in the treatment of gastric disorders, particularly those associated with "stomach heat" and pain in TCM theory. It is currently being investigated in Phase 4 clinical trials in China as a substitute for bismuth in a quadruple therapy regimen for the eradication of *Helicobacter pylori* infection. The regimen typically includes a proton pump inhibitor (such as rabeprazole) and two antibiotics (such as amoxicillin and clarithromycin). The pellets are intended to improve the efficacy of *H. pylori* eradication while potentially reducing the adverse effects often associated with traditional bismuth-based quadruple therapies.
